The fundamental operation of PNPs is the same as that of NPNs, but the polarities are reversed in a way that sometimes leads to awkward circuit configurations. 1. Current flows from emitter to base; the emitter must be ~0.6 V above the base in order to forward bias the base-emitter junction. 2. WebOnce again, PNP transistors are just as valid to use in the common-collector configuration as NPN transistors. The gain calculations are all the same, as is the non-inverting of the amplified signal. The only difference is in voltage polarities and current directions shown in the figure below. PNP version of the common-collector amplifier.
